Broadband speeds in CT7
Share of CT7 premises by the fastest download speed available, averaged across all 410 postcodes in the district.
Alternative infrastructure deployment is extraordinary: 69.3% of postcodes depend on non-cable provision, more than double any other district examined. This suggests fibre and cable infrastructure gaps that aerial solutions address systematically across 284 postcodes. Gigabit reaches 77.6% (318 postcodes), and superfast covers 93.5%, implying 27 postcodes without 30 Mbps access. The speed profile reflects this split reliance: 77.6% sit above 300 Mbps, 15.9% occupy the intermediate 30 to 300 Mbps band (65 postcodes), and 0.6% remain below 10 Mbps (just 2 to 3 postcodes). Below-USO shortfalls are nil. The 69.3% deployment density indicates systematic coverage planning where alternative technologies fill gaps uneconomical for wired networks, ensuring universal service across dispersed areas.
Source: Ofcom Connected Nations. Percentages are district-wide averages of postcode-level availability, so rows may not sum to exactly 100%.
